Turkey drumsticks

  • Perfect size
  • A or B grade


Subo's turkey drumsticks are sourced with great care. The quality of our frozen turkey drumsticks is thoroughly checked. We source our turkey drumsticks from Holland, Germany Belgium, France, Poland and Brazil.

Want to know more about Turkey drumsticks?

Get in touch with Daan Dullaart, our CEO, to discover your possibilities with Subo International.